Imo, thoughts originate dependently, they arise as a result of past habituation and present circumstances coming together. If you notice that when circumstances change so do our thoughts....
When your painting your beautiful pieces of Art where do the thoughts of what you are going to painting come from and why do they change as you move around the canvas onto the next bit, I'd say the circumstances have changed so does the thoughts....

When I have similar childhood memories I find something in the ' now ' has triggered the thoughts/memory to arise. The subconscious mind plays a big part in our lives that we don't always notice. Sometimes finding the ' trigger ' helps me understand . Have a read about 'storehouse consciousness' ...
